> > Dear Abhilash,
> >
> > please, have a look at temperatures in your system: Starting from
> > 798th step onwards it is rising very rapidly., much above the defined
> > 300 K. This may be caused by a plethora of issues but generally it
> > means that your system is unstable. Restraint energy in your system is
> > pretty high comparing to the restraint value that you defined - it may
> > be the main cause of your system's instability.
